一、问题现象与初步诊断
TP钱包在部分场景中出现“资金不刷新/余额不更新”的现象,常见表现包括:界面余额与链上实际余额不同步、历史交易未显示、代币提现/转入后未及时反映等。此类问题往往是前端缓存、网络请求、后端服务、节点同步以及链上交易确认等多重因素叠加的结果。要避免简单归因,需要从客户端、服务端、区块链网络以及合约权限等多方面同时排查。以下内容围绕问题可能的原因、影响因素与解决路径展开分析,并把“安全峰会”“合约权限”“专业建议分析”“全球化智能化发展”“实时市场监控”“多维支付”等要点纳入风险治理与产品迭代的框架之中。
二、技术层面原因解析
1) 客户端缓存与刷新逻辑
- 许多钱包采用轮询或事件推送混合的刷新机制,若缓存未及时清除、刷新间隔设定过长,界面可能长时间显示旧数据。
- 本地离线签名或离线备份数据的同步也可能引发短时偏差。
- 解决要点:优先核对客户端刷新策略、清理缓存、在关键操作后强制拉取最新状态,并提供“手动刷新”选项;对频繁变动的数值采用热更新且记录最近一次刷新时间戳。
2) 网络环境与RPC节点稳定性
- RPC节点宕机、网络抖动、跨节点数据不一致都会导致数据回落或延迟显示。
- 跨链/多链场景下,节点之间的时钟差异、共识最终性差异也会带来短时不同步。
- 解决要点:使用多节点并行查询、实现节点健康监控和自动切换(failover),为关键请求设置超时与重试策略;提供可选的自建节点、官方节点与公用节点的切换入口。
3) 区块链确认状态与交易落账延迟
- 对于未确认的交易,钱包可能显示为“交易中”状态,直到达到一定确认数才把余额更新到可用状态。
- 交易吞吐量高峰期,打包延迟、Mempool拥堵等会放大延迟。
- 解决要点:明确区分“可用余额”和“锁定/待确认余额”的显示逻辑,提供交易状态实时刷新与确认阈值自定义选项;对高峰期增加额外的链上数据采集粒度。
4) 合约权限与授权变动
- 如果钱包依赖智能合约或托管账户,授权额度的变动(如授权某应用 spend unlimited)会影响余额显示的可用性。
- 未授权变动、授权过期、授权撤销等都会导致第三方合约的余额显示异常。
- 解决要点:定期对授权记录进行对比,提供“一键撤销”入口,告知用户近期授权变动对余额的潜在影响;在授权变更时同步刷新相关余额与交易信息。
5) 安全策略与账户异常
- 风控策略、冷钱包与热钱包分离、私钥保护等若出现异常访问,可能触发账户冻结或临时隐藏余额以防止风险。
- 解决要点:清晰的安全告警机制、多因素认证、硬件钱包兼容性与分级授权策略,确保在保障安全前提下尽量减少对正常操作的影响。
6) 版本与服务端问题
- 版本缺陷、缓存错位、后端余额计算逻辑变更未向下兼容等都会造成显示不一致。
- 解决要点:提供版本兼容性测试、回滚机制、详细变更日志;在升级时给出明确的升级路径与回滚方案。
7) 跨网络与跨账户的场景
- 在多链钱包或跨链桥接场景下,数据源可能来自不同的链与不同的服务,易产生时序错位。
- 解决要点:对跨网络数据源实施统一的时间戳对齐与一致性校验,提供跨链状态聚合视图。
三、与“安全峰会”的关联分析
- 安全峰会强调端到端的资产安全、私钥保护、合约审计、去中心化身份与多方计算(MPC)等前沿议题。对于“资金不刷新”的场景,峰会提出的安全治理思想有以下落点:
1) 私钥与密钥管理:推崇硬件钱包、MPC、分散式密钥方案,以降低单点泄露导致的余额异常。
2) 审计与透明度:对关键合约、授权流程进行持续审计,公开安全对照表与变更记录,提升用户对余额显示背后数据源的信任。
3) 风控与异常处理:建立更清晰的风险告警、自动冻结、双人复核等机制,确保异常勿扰正常使用。
4) 平台生态治理:鼓励跨钱包、跨链协作,建立统一的安全标准与数据互操作性,以减少因数据源不一致导致的显示问题。
四、关于“合约权限”的专业解读
- 合约权限通常涉及授权额度、允许访问的合约地址以及允许的操作种类。若钱包在授权后未及时刷新余额,可能是因为授权变动未即时反映在可用余额中,或授权被撤销后仍显示历史状态。
- 专业建议:
1) 定期审视授权记录,及时撤销不再需要的授权。
2) 对高风险授权设定额度上限,避免一次性暴露全部资金。
3) 在变动授权后,强制执行一次链上数据刷新,确保本地余额与链上状态的一致性。
4) 提供清晰的授权变动通知,帮助用户快速识别异常授权行为。
五、全球化与智能化发展趋势下的应用要点
- 全球化:钱包需支持多语言、跨币种、跨法域合规要求,提升全球用户的使用体验与法务合规性。
- 智能化:通过机器学习优化风控、交易推荐与异常检测,提升安全性与响应速度,但需防止过度依赖造成的误报与误判。
- 跨境支付与互操作性:加强与支付通道、稳定币、法币入口的协同,降低跨境交易成本与延迟。
六、实时市场监控与数据准确性
- 实时市场监控应包含多源价格数据、成交量与深度信息,避免单源数据导致的价格错位与显示滞后。
- 实现要点:接入多家可信价格源、引入去信任的预言机、对重要价格变动设置阈值告警、对价格显示使用本地缓存与刷新策略的组合,以平衡时效与稳定性。
七、多维支付场景的落地策略
- 多维支付包括法币入口、加密货币支付、跨链支付、二维码收付、暗号/口令支付等多管齐下的支付能力。
- 在 TP 钱包中应提供清晰的支付通道切换、透明的手续费与结算时间、以及对接商户的稳定性保证,确保在多场景下都能快速刷新余额、订单状态与交易结果。
八、面向用户的行动指南
- 如果遇到“余额不刷新”问题,建议:1) 先尝试手动刷新、切换网络节点、清理缓存;2) 确认最近的授权记录与交易状态;3) 检查应用版本与节点选择;4) 将可疑授权撤销并重新授权;5) 如问题持续,联系官方客服并提供交易哈希、时间戳、截图等证据以便追踪。
九、结语
- 资金不刷新是一个多源因素叠加的现象,需要从前端刷新逻辑、节点稳定性、区块链确认、以及合约授权等多方面综合治理。在全球化与智能化的发展背景下,通过加强安全治理、完善授权管理、提升数据源的可信度与一致性、以及优化多维支付通道,DT钱包的资金刷新体验将更稳健、更透明。
评论
CryptoNova
问题多来自缓存与RPC节点,建议先尝试切换节点并清理缓存,若继续则对授权记录进行核查。
杨风
确保最近的授权未被滥用,交易哈希和时间戳保存好,便于对账与排查。
TechieAda
开发端应实现多源数据聚合与兜底重试,用户端提供手动刷新和缓存TTL可显著改善体验。
李晴
安全峰会的讨论对提升钱包安全很有帮助,后续应将MPC与硬件钱包更紧密集成。